Understanding Dysphagia: A Brief Overview

What is Dysphagia?

Dysphagia refers to difficulties in ingesting that can take place at different phases of the swallowing process. The reasons can vary from neurological problems like stroke or Parkinson's illness to architectural irregularities in the throat or esophagus.

Types of Dysphagia

Oropharyngeal Dysphagia: Difficulty launching swallowing. Esophageal Dysphagia: Sensation of food being embeded the esophagus.

Why is Dysphagia Important?

Understanding dysphagia is dysphagia support important for caregivers as it directly affects a person's quality of life. Correct monitoring can aid stop major health and wellness risks connected with poor nutrition and dehydration.

Essential Abilities Covered in Dysphagia Care Training

Recognizing Symptoms of Dysphagia

Training must focus on identifying usual indications such as coughing during dishes or issues of pain while swallowing.

Safe Feeding Techniques

Caregivers learn how to customize food textures and execute appropriate positioning strategies that reduce choking risks.
